Vanished Valley Brewing Company was founded in Ludlow, Massachusetts, with a vision to craft highly aromatic, fresh, and hazy beers. Known for their community-driven approach, they have quickly become a staple of the New England craft beer scene.
Crafted in the heart of Ludlow, Massachusetts, this New England IPA showcases the brewery's dedication to modern hopping techniques. The recipe focuses on late-addition hops to maximize juicy aromatics while keeping bitterness exceptionally smooth.
